How this VIN pattern is read
A 17-character VIN carries two kinds of information: what was built, and which one it is. This page is the first kind — the nine highlighted positions.
| Positions | Characters | What they encode |
|---|---|---|
| 1–3 | WP0 | DR. ING. H.C.F. PORSCHE AG · World manufacturer identifier |
| 4–8 | AB299 | Model, body style, engine and restraint system |
| 9 | × | Check digit — computed per vehicle, not part of the build |
| 10 | 9 | Model year — 2009 |
| 11 | × | Assembly plant |
| 12–17 | ×××××× | Production sequence number, unique to each vehicle |

Where this data comes from
Specification fields are decoded from the manufacturer's filings in the NHTSA vPIC database, keyed on VIN positions 1–8 and 10. We publish the filed values as they stand and leave out anything the filing does not record.
Prices are asking prices from 15 live dealer listings decoded to this build , last updated September 6, 2026 . They are what sellers ask, not what buyers paid.
Vehicle counts come from the 369 VINs of this build we have seen in dealer inventory. They are a sample of the road population, not a production figure.
